Job Summary Provide diagnostic and surgical services to the patients of the Charleston Area Medical Center, Inc. and its affiliates per the terms of the employment contract. Responsibilities • Physician will provide care to CAMC patients in the field of Orthopedic Spine Surgery. Compliance with the highest standards of medical art and science will be demonstrated. Care will be delivered in the appropriate setting and coordinated with the staff present at each site. The physician will take the lead in all patient care issues and will be ultimately responsible for the outcome of the encounter. • Physician will provide services on a "full time" employment basis. This may take place in the Ortho/Neuro Office or at any of the CAMC facilities, as dictated by need. Work activity will be comprised of but not limited to the following professional activity: patient evaluation, management, consultations, office clinic, rounding, operating room. • Physician will provide leadership in the development of CAMC Orthopedic Spine Surgery program. • Physician will collaborate with CAMC purchasing/operating rooms to continuously improve balance of quality and pricing for supplies and implants. • Physician will coordinate recruitment of neurosurgical and orthopedic staff and will collaborate in other neurosurgery , orthopedic, surgical and ancillary/adjunctive specialties. • Physician will collaborate with physicians with patient referrals and call coverage. • Physician will provide provider expertise in marketing of programs and will work in support of CAMC Marketing representatives/initiatives. • Physician will provide leadership to and supervision of employed neurosurgery and orthopedic surgery staff. • Physician will demonstrate willingness to review practice related data from local, regional and national databases and other clinical quality and Value Based Purchasing initiatives to improve processes and outcomes for continuous learning and advancement of care and services. • Physician will work collaboratively with the assigned Practice Administrator of the Neurosurgery Department for day-to-day operations. • Physician will report to Senior Vice President for Ambulatory Services and Regional Hospitals or his or her designee (including the Practice Administrator) for administrative and daily operations, or designee. For practice and professional matters, the Physician will be subject to the authority of the Chief Medical Officer. • Physician will cooperate with CAMC to assure schedules that provide on-site twenty-four hour coverage for patient care and access to Specialty services. Physician will make necessary changes in the schedule to meet day-to-day patient care demands for safe and appropriate provision of care on a continuous basis. • Physician will participate in quality improvement initiatives including but not limited to, monitoring and reporting compliance with pertinent protocols and evidence-based guidelines and to improve the goals of the individual and collective clinical performance of the Specialty. • Direct the development and implementation of standard operating procedures, policies, evidence-based protocols, guidelines, order sets and clinical documentation tools to support Specialty care which is safe, timely, efficient, effective, equitable and patient centered. • Act as a liaison for the Orthopedic Spine Surgery program to medical staff and other hospital departments to proactively promote cooperation and effectiveness. • Participate with Administration in the development and implementation of the business model for the Specialty department, to assure the provision of care which is based on enhanced access, lower cost and improved quality, including but not limited to accurate and timely documentation, correct coding and revenue cycle improvements. • Assure on-going professional development and continuing medical education regarding the practice of Orthopedic Spine Surgery • Direct and coordinate all aspects of the Orthopedic Spine Surgery program, including but not limited to access, cost and quality outcomes reporting. • Continue with the provision of patient care services as a practicing clinician/surgeon. • Support and implement new technology and quality reporting initiatives, including but not limited to electronic medical records, e-prescribing, PQRS and other initiatives reasonably requested by CAMC. • Work with management, staff and providers to create and maintain an environment that promotes high levels of employee and patient satisfaction and engagement.
